Quarterly Planning Note — Divestiture of the Coastal Tooling Unit

For the finance team: the sale of the Coastal Tooling unit to Pellmark Industries remains on track for close in Q3. Please finalize the carve-out balance sheet, reconcile intercompany positions, and prepare the working-capital adjustment schedule by month-end. Audit support requests should be prioritized. For planning purposes, note the following sensitive item:

internal memo for hawef-kahif: The finance team signed off on a budget of $25.9 million for Project Sorox. The renewal with Pelokek Logistics closes at $51.7 million a year, 52 percent below the last contract.

## Who to ping about GiftNote

Welcome aboard! GiftNote is our donation-receipt mailer for the Larchfield Fund. Template tweaks go to the comms folks; delivery failures and bounce weirdness go to the platform crew. Don't push template changes on Fridays — receipts batch over the weekend. For anything GiftNote-related, start with the address below.

billing contact of kaweg-tajeg = drudor.lamion.oliath@torvalabs.test

Welcome to the team. A quick note on responsibilities: FareForge, our rules engine for computing shipping fees across the Delverton and Kessway zones, is changing hands this sprint. The outgoing owner has documented the rule-authoring workflow, the staging simulator, and the quarterly tariff reconciliation in the team handbook, so please read those pages before proposing rule changes. Escalations for miscalculated fees follow the usual incident path. From Monday onward, the accountable engineer for FareForge is named below.

account owner for tawef-yadug: Jorius Normir Silath